دوره: Tailwind CSS از صفر تا پروژه-محور بر روی فلش 32GB

500,000 تومان950,000 تومان

نام محصول به انگلیسی Udemy – Tailwind CSS From Scratch | Learn By Building Projects
نام محصول به فارسی دوره: Tailwind CSS از صفر تا پروژه-محور بر روی فلش 32GB
زبان انگلیسی با زیرنویس فارسی
نوع محصول آموزش ویدیویی
نحوه تحویل ارائه شده بر روی فلش مموری

🎓 مجموعه‌ای بی‌نظیر

  • زیرنویس کاملاً فارسی برای درک آسان و سریع
  • ارائه‌شده روی فلش 32 گیگابایتی
  • آماده ارسال فوری به سراسر کشور

📚 شروع یادگیری از همین امروز — فرصت رشد را از دست نده!

جهت پیگیری سفارش، می‌توانید از طریق واتس‌اپ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.

دوره: Tailwind CSS از صفر تا پروژه-محور بر روی فلش 32GB

در دنیای پرشتاب توسعه وب، سرعت و کارایی در طراحی واسط کاربری (UI) از اهمیت بالایی برخوردار است. Tailwind CSS یک فریم‌ورک CSS مبتنی بر ابزارک‌ها (Utility-First) است که به توسعه‌دهندگان این امکان را می‌دهد تا با نوشتن کمترین کد CSS، رابط‌های کاربری زیبا، مدرن و کاملاً واکنش‌گرا را طراحی کنند. این دوره جامع، شما را از مفاهیم پایه‌ای Tailwind CSS تا ساخت پروژه‌های واقعی و پیچیده، گام به گام هدایت می‌کند.

نکته بسیار مهم: محتوای این دوره روی یک فلش مموری ۳۲ گیگابایتی ارائه می‌شود و امکان دانلود آن وجود ندارد. این رویکرد به شما اطمینان می‌دهد که دسترسی پایدار و بدون نیاز به اینترنت به تمامی محتوای آموزشی خواهید داشت و می‌توانید آن را در هر زمان و مکانی مشاهده کنید.

چرا Tailwind CSS انتخاب هوشمندانه‌ای است؟

روش‌های سنتی نوشتن CSS اغلب منجر به کدهای تکراری، فایل‌های بزرگ و دشواری در نگهداری می‌شوند. Tailwind CSS با ارائه مجموعه‌ای غنی از کلاس‌های ابزارکی، این چالش‌ها را برطرف می‌کند و فرآیند طراحی و توسعه را متحول می‌سازد. مزایای کلیدی استفاده از Tailwind CSS عبارتند از:

  • سرعت بالا در توسعه: با استفاده از هزاران کلاس آماده و قابل ترکیب، نیاز به نوشتن CSS سفارشی به حداقل می‌رسد و می‌توانید طراحی‌ها را در زمان بسیار کوتاه‌تری پیاده‌سازی کنید.
  • کدهای تمیز و قابل نگهداری: از آنجایی که استایل‌ها مستقیماً در HTML اعمال می‌شوند، پیدا کردن و تغییر استایل‌ها آسان‌تر است و منطق استایل‌دهی در کنار ساختار کد قرار می‌گیرد.
  • کاهش حجم فایل‌های CSS: با ابزارهایی مانند PurgeCSS، فقط کلاس‌هایی که واقعاً در پروژه خود استفاده می‌کنید در فایل نهایی باقی می‌مانند، که به بهبود عملکرد وب‌سایت کمک می‌کند.
  • انعطاف‌پذیری بی‌نظیر: برخلاف بسیاری از فریم‌ورک‌ها که استایل‌های از پیش تعریف شده و ثابتی دارند، Tailwind CSS به شما کنترل کاملی بر طراحی خود می‌دهد و می‌توانید به راحتی استایل‌های پیش‌فرض را سفارشی کنید یا تم‌های اختصاصی بسازید.
  • سازگاری کامل با جاوااسکریپت و فریم‌ورک‌ها: به راحتی می‌توانید از Tailwind CSS در کنار React، Vue، Angular، Next.js و سایر کتابخانه‌ها و فریم‌ورک‌های مدرن جاوااسکریپت استفاده کنید و تجربه توسعه یکپارچه‌ای داشته باشید.

این فریم‌ورک به شما اجازه می‌دهد تا با تمرکز بر روی منطق کسب و کار، زمان کمتری را صرف نگرانی در مورد طراحی و استایلینگ کنید و این به معنای توسعه سریع‌تر، کارآمدتر و لذت‌بخش‌تر است.

این دوره برای چه کسانی مناسب است؟

این دوره جامع برای طیف وسیعی از افراد، از مبتدیان مطلق در طراحی وب تا توسعه‌دهندگان با تجربه که به دنبال بهینه‌سازی فرآیند کاری خود هستند، طراحی شده است:

  • توسعه‌دهندگان فرانت‌اند: کسانی که می‌خواهند فرآیند طراحی و پیاده‌سازی رابط کاربری خود را تسریع بخشند و با یک ابزار مدرن و قدرتمند آشنا شوند.
  • طراحان وب: افرادی که به دنبال ابزاری قدرتمند برای تبدیل ایده‌های طراحی خود به کد HTML و CSS با حداقل تلاش و حداکثر کنترل هستند.
  • دانشجویان و تازه‌کاران: کسانی که می‌خواهند یک مهارت بسیار کاربردی، پرتقاضا و مورد نیاز بازار کار را فرا بگیرند و با ساخت پروژه‌های واقعی، پورتفولیوی خود را تقویت کنند.
  • توسعه‌دهندگانی که با فریم‌ورک‌های دیگر کار کرده‌اند: افرادی که به دنبال جایگزینی کارآمدتر و انعطاف‌پذیرتر برای Bootstrap، Bulma یا سایر فریم‌ورک‌های CSS هستند و می‌خواهند کنترل بیشتری بر خروجی نهایی داشته باشند.
  • مدیران محصول و کارآفرینان: کسانی که می‌خواهند فرآیند ساخت MVP (حداقل محصول قابل ارائه) را تسریع بخشند و با سرعت بیشتری ایده‌های خود را به واقعیت تبدیل کنند.

چه چیزی در این دوره خواهید آموخت؟

با اتمام این دوره جامع، شما به یک متخصص Tailwind CSS تبدیل خواهید شد و قادر خواهید بود با اطمینان کامل به طراحی و پیاده‌سازی رابط‌های کاربری مدرن بپردازید. مهارت‌هایی که کسب خواهید کرد عبارتند از:

  • درک و به‌کارگیری کامل مفاهیم Utility-First و نحوه تفکر در چارچوب Tailwind CSS.
  • تسلط بر تمامی کلاس‌های اصلی Tailwind CSS (مانند طرح‌بندی، تایپوگرافی، رنگ‌ها، فاصله‌گذاری، پس‌زمینه، مرزها، سایه‌ها، فیلترها و غیره).
  • پیاده‌سازی طراحی‌های کاملاً واکنش‌گرا (Responsive Design) با استفاده از نقاط شکست (Breakpoints) پیش‌فرض و سفارشی، برای نمایش بهینه در تمام دستگاه‌ها.
  • توانایی سفارشی‌سازی و توسعه Tailwind CSS با استفاده از فایل `tailwind.config.js` برای تعریف رنگ‌ها، فونت‌ها، اندازه‌ها و سایر مقادیر سفارشی.
  • استفاده از پلاگین‌ها و ابزارهای متنوع موجود در اکوسیستم Tailwind CSS برای افزایش کارایی.
  • پیاده‌سازی حالت‌های مختلف UI مانند حالت تاریک (Dark Mode) و سایر حالت‌های سفارشی بر اساس نیاز پروژه.
  • به حداکثر رساندن سرعت توسعه با استفاده از JIT Mode (Just-in-Time) و درک نحوه کار آن.
  • ساخت کامپوننت‌های UI پیچیده و قابل استفاده مجدد با رویکرد Tailwind CSS.
  • توانایی ساخت و تکمیل پروژه‌های واقعی و کاربردی از صفر تا صد با استفاده از Tailwind CSS.

مزایای کلیدی این دوره

این دوره نه تنها دانش تئوری را به شما می‌آموزد، بلکه با رویکرد پروژه-محور و ویژگی‌های خاص خود، شما را برای بازار کار آماده می‌کند و تجربه یادگیری بی‌نظیری را ارائه می‌دهد:

  • یادگیری عملی و پروژه-محور: با ساخت چندین پروژه واقعی و چالش‌برانگیز، تجربه عملی ارزشمندی کسب خواهید کرد که در هیچ دوره تئوری نمی‌توانید بیابید.
  • محتوای به‌روز و جامع: دوره با آخرین نسخه‌ها و قابلیت‌های Tailwind CSS همگام است و تمام جنبه‌های ضروری این فریم‌ورک را پوشش می‌دهد.
  • کاهش وابستگی به کتابخانه‌های UI سنگین: به شما کمک می‌کند تا کنترل بیشتری بر طراحی خود داشته باشید و از کدهای اضافی و بلااستفاده جلوگیری کنید.
  • بهبود مهارت‌های حل مسئله: با چالش‌های واقعی طراحی وب روبرو خواهید شد و راه‌حل‌های بهینه و خلاقانه را فرا می‌گیرید.
  • افزایش ارزش در بازار کار: تسلط بر Tailwind CSS یک مهارت بسیار مطلوب برای توسعه‌دهندگان فرانت‌اند است که فرصت‌های شغلی شما را گسترش می‌دهد.
  • انتقال محتوا بر روی فلش مموری ۳۲ گیگابایتی: تمامی محتوا روی یک فلش ۳۲ گیگابایتی با کیفیت بالا ارائه می‌شود که امکان دسترسی آفلاین و بدون نیاز به اینترنت را فراهم می‌کند. این ویژگی برای مناطقی با دسترسی محدود به اینترنت یا برای کسانی که ترجیح می‌دهند محتوا را به صورت فیزیکی و پایدار در اختیار داشته باشند، ایده‌آل است.

پیش‌نیازهای دوره

برای بهره‌مندی کامل و کسب بهترین نتایج از این دوره، داشتن دانش پایه در زمینه‌های زیر توصیه می‌شود:

  • آشنایی مقدماتی با HTML: توانایی ساختاردهی محتوا با تگ‌های HTML و درک ساختار اساسی صفحات وب.
  • آشنایی مقدماتی با CSS: درک مفاهیم اولیه مانند انتخاب‌گرها، ویژگی‌ها، Box Model و نحوه استایل‌دهی به عناصر.
  • آشنایی با Command Line / Terminal (در حد مقدماتی): برای نصب و اجرای ابزارهای مرتبط با Node.js و Tailwind CSS.
  • نیازی به تجربه قبلی با Tailwind CSS نیست؛ دوره کاملاً از صفر شروع می‌شود و تمامی مفاهیم از پایه آموزش داده خواهند شد.

ساختار و سرفصل‌های دوره

این دوره به دقت ساختاربندی شده تا یادگیری شما روان، منطقی و مؤثر باشد. سرفصل‌های اصلی به شرح زیر است:

  • بخش ۱: مقدمه‌ای بر Tailwind CSS و راه‌اندازی
    • Tailwind CSS چیست و چرا در اکوسیستم توسعه وب اهمیت دارد؟
    • نصب و راه‌اندازی Tailwind CSS در یک پروژه جدید.
    • مقایسه Tailwind CSS با فریم‌ورک‌های دیگر مانند Bootstrap.
  • بخش ۲: مفاهیم هسته‌ای و کلاس‌های ابزارکی
    • مرور جامع بر تمامی دسته‌های کلاس‌های ابزارکی (رنگ‌ها، فاصله‌گذاری، تایپوگرافی، پس‌زمینه، مرزها، سایه‌ها، فیلترها و غیره).
    • کار با Flexbox و Grid برای ایجاد طرح‌بندی‌های پیچیده و واکنش‌گرا.
    • درک و استفاده از Variants (حالت‌های هاور، فوکوس، فعال، دیسایبل و غیره).
  • بخش ۳: طراحی واکنش‌گرا (Responsive Design) در Tailwind
    • کار با نقاط شکست (Breakpoints) پیش‌فرض و نحوه تعریف نقاط شکست سفارشی.
    • ساخت رابط‌های کاربری که در تمام اندازه‌های صفحه نمایش، از موبایل تا دسکتاپ، عالی به نظر برسند.
  • بخش ۴: سفارشی‌سازی و توسعه Tailwind CSS
    • استفاده از فایل `tailwind.config.js` برای تعریف رنگ‌ها، فونت‌ها، اندازه‌ها و پلاگین‌های سفارشی.
    • افزودن پلاگین‌ها و استفاده از قابلیت‌های اکستند کردن برای افزایش امکانات Tailwind.
    • آشنایی با @apply برای استخراج و ساخت کامپوننت‌های قابل استفاده مجدد.
  • بخش ۵: ویژگی‌های پیشرفته و بهینه‌سازی
    • پیاده‌سازی Dark Mode برای رابط کاربری.
    • کار با JIT Mode (Just-in-Time) و بهینه‌سازی فرآیند ساخت و رندر CSS.
    • آشنایی با انیمیشن‌ها، ترنزیشن‌ها و ترنسفورم‌ها در Tailwind CSS.
  • بخش ۶: پروژه‌های عملی و کاربردی
    • ساخت یک صفحه فرود (Landing Page) مدرن و کاملاً واکنش‌گرا.
    • طراحی و پیاده‌سازی یک داشبورد مدیریتی پیچیده.
    • ساخت کامپوننت‌های رایج وب مانند کارت محصولات، فرم‌های ورود/ثبت‌نام، ناوبری‌ها و مودال‌ها.
    • پروژه‌های چالش‌برانگیز دیگر برای تثبیت آموخته‌ها.

رویکرد پروژه-محور: یادگیری با ساختن

یکی از نقاط قوت اصلی این دوره، تمرکز بی‌نظیر بر یادگیری از طریق ساخت پروژه است. ما معتقدیم تئوری‌ها و مفاهیم تنها زمانی واقعاً درک می‌شوند که در عمل و در سناریوهای واقعی به کار گرفته شوند. در طول این دوره، شما چندین پروژه کامل و کاربردی را از ابتدا تا انتها پیاده‌سازی خواهید کرد. این پروژه‌ها به شما کمک می‌کنند تا:

  • مهارت‌های خود را در محیطی واقعی و شبیه‌سازی شده از دنیای واقعی به کار ببرید و آنها را تقویت کنید.
  • با چالش‌های معمول توسعه وب آشنا شوید و توانایی حل مسئله خود را افزایش دهید.
  • یک مجموعه قوی و قابل ارائه از پروژه‌ها را برای رزومه و پورتفولیوی خود جمع‌آوری کنید.
  • از مفاهیم آموخته شده در سناریوهای مختلف استفاده کنید و آنها را به خوبی درونی‌سازی کنید، که منجر به یادگیری عمیق‌تر می‌شود.

این رویکرد تضمین می‌کند که شما پس از اتمام دوره، نه تنها دانش نظری عمیقی از Tailwind CSS خواهید داشت، بلکه قادر به پیاده‌سازی آن در پروژه‌های واقعی و ورود به بازار کار به عنوان یک توسعه‌دهنده ماهر نیز خواهید بود.

نحوه دسترسی به محتوای دوره: فلش مموری ۳۲ گیگابایتی

همانطور که قبلاً تأکید شد، توجه کنید که این دوره روی فلش مموری ۳۲ گیگابایتی هست و داننلودی نیست. این شیوه منحصر به فرد ارائه محتوا، مزایای متعددی را برای شما به ارمغان می‌آورد:

  • دسترسی آفلاین و دائمی: پس از دریافت فلش مموری، برای مشاهده محتوای دوره نیازی به اتصال به اینترنت نخواهید داشت. این امر به ویژه برای کاربران در مناطق با اینترنت محدود یا پرهزینه، و همچنین برای کسانی که می‌خواهند در سفر یا بدون دغدغه قطع اینترنت آموزش ببینند، بسیار مفید است.
  • قابلیت حمل بالا: می‌توانید فلش مموری را به راحتی با خود حمل کرده و محتوا را روی هر کامپیوتری که به پورت USB مجهز است، مشاهده کنید. این ویژگی امکان یادگیری در هر مکان و هر زمان را فراهم می‌کند.
  • امنیت محتوا: محتوا به صورت فیزیکی و با اطمینان کامل در اختیار شما قرار می‌گیرد، که نگرانی‌ها در مورد از دست رفتن فایل‌ها، مشکلات مربوط به دانلودهای ناقص یا محدودیت‌های پهنای باند را از بین می‌برد.
  • کیفیت تضمین‌شده: تمامی ویدئوها و فایل‌های پروژه با کیفیت بالا و به صورت بهینه بر روی فلش مموری بارگذاری شده‌اند تا بهترین تجربه یادگیری را داشته باشید.

این روش تضمین می‌کند که شما بدون هیچ مانعی به یک منبع آموزشی جامع، پایدار و کاملاً در دسترس دسترسی داشته باشید و بتوانید بر روی یادگیری تمرکز کنید.

با شرکت در این دوره Tailwind CSS از صفر تا پروژه-محور، شما گامی بزرگ در جهت تسلط بر یکی از مدرن‌ترین و کارآمدترین فریم‌ورک‌های CSS برخواهید داشت. این سرمایه‌گذاری بر روی مهارت‌های شما، دریچه‌های جدیدی را در دنیای توسعه وب برایتان خواهد گشود و شما را به یک توسعه‌دهنده فرانت‌اند قدرتمندتر و با اعتماد به نفس بالاتر تبدیل خواهد کرد. همین امروز تصمیم خود را برای شروع این سفر آموزشی جذاب بگیرید و آینده شغلی خود را متحول کنید.

نوع دریافت دوره

دریافت دوره بر روی فلش مموری و ارسال پستی, دریافت دوره فقط به صورت دانلودی (بدون فلش مموری)

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“دوره: Tailwind CSS از صفر تا پروژه-محور بر روی فلش 32GB”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ا